Another positive experience of Economía is its impact on international trade. With the rise of globalization, countries are now more interconnected than ever before. Economía has allowed countries to specialize in the production of goods and services that they have a comparative advantage in, and then trade with other countries for goods and services that they lack. This has led to increased efficiency, lower costs, and a wider variety of products for consumers. As a result, international trade has not only boosted the global economy but has also improved the standard of living for people around the world.

In addition to these positive experiences, Economía has also played a crucial role in promoting economic stability. By understanding the causes of inflation, unemployment, and economic downturns, governments can implement policies to stabilize the economy. This has led to a more predictable and secure economic environment, which is essential for businesses and individuals to thrive. Economía has also helped countries recover from economic crises, such as the Great Recession of 2008, by providing solutions and strategies to overcome these challenges.
